Set on the banks of the River Derwent near Belper in Derbyshireâs Amber Valley, this beautiful and spacious period home offers delightful accommodation to extended families and groups of friends. Tranquillity and privacy are assured thanks to the private lane that leads to the property, which keen ramblers can follow to find a wealth of riverside walks that lead to Belper (1 mile) and other surrounding towns and villages. Belper offers a charming mix of antique shops and traditional pubs and restaurants, as well as an independent cinema for rainy days. Other nearby towns with just as much Derbyshire character include Matlock (10 miles) and Ashbourne (11 miles). With the Peak District National Park only 12.5 miles away, this is a great base for hikers, cyclists, and fellow lovers of the outdoors. Closer attractions include Belper River Gardens (1 mile), White Peak Distillery, and the Great British Car Journey Museum (both within 4 miles).
